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Referring to fig. 1 to 3, the present invention provides a technical solution: a manual unlocking device of a sliding door for urban rail transit operation comprises a fixed sleeve 1, wherein a limiting disc 4 is arranged at the lower end of the fixed sleeve 1, a baffle 20 is arranged on the fixed sleeve 1, a fixed frame 21 is arranged on the baffle 20, only a prying mechanism is arranged on the fixed frame 21, the prying mechanism comprises a first rotating cylinder 28, a lever 8 is arranged on one side of the first rotating cylinder 28, a connecting plate 13 is arranged on the other side of the first rotating cylinder 28, the connecting plate 13 is connected with a supporting frame 9, a second rotating cylinder 3 is sleeved on the supporting frame 9, a limiting strip 7 is arranged on the periphery of the second rotating cylinder 3, and a handle 6 is arranged on the second rotating cylinder 3; the fixing sleeve is characterized in that a fixing barrel 26 is arranged in the fixing barrel 1, an expansion rod 27 penetrates through the fixing barrel 26, a compression spring 25 is arranged on the expansion rod 27, a moving block 29 is arranged below the expansion rod 27, the lever 8 is connected with the moving block 29, a locking barrel 10 is arranged below the moving block 29, a steel wire rope 11 is arranged in the locking barrel 10, and an unlocking mechanism is arranged at the lower end of the steel wire rope 11.
When the manual unlocking device is used, the limiting disc 4 is arranged below the fixed sleeve 1, in the upward movement process of the steel wire rope 11, the limiting disc 4 can limit the protective pipe 18 on the steel wire rope 11, the protective pipe 18 is prevented from moving along with the steel wire rope 11, the fixed frame 21 is provided with a prying mechanism, when the unlocking is needed, the handle 6 is pulled, the handle 6 enables the lever 8 to lift the movable block 29 upwards, the movable block 29 extrudes the telescopic rod 27 while lifting, the telescopic rod 27 extrudes the compression spring 25 to enable the telescopic rod 27 to stretch in the fixed cylinder 26, the steel wire rope 11 is pulled to unlock a sliding door of the device, the lever 8 principle enables a worker to easily pull the handle 6 when unlocking, the working strength of the worker is reduced, the unlocking efficiency is improved, the compression spring 25 enables the device to be always kept in a locking state, and the structure of the device is more stable, the locking cylinder 10 fixes the wire rope 11 so that the wire rope 11 does not easily fall down to damage the device.
Referring to fig. 2, the unlocking mechanism includes an extrusion block 12, the extrusion block 12 is connected to a sliding block 15, one side of the sliding block 15 is connected to a locking rod 16, a return spring 17 is sleeved on the locking rod 16, when the steel wire rope 11 is pulled, the steel wire rope 11 drives the extrusion block 12 to move upwards to push the sliding block 15, so that the locking rod 16 on the sliding block 15 is moved out of the sliding door by the thrust of the return spring 17 to unlock the sliding door, a limit rod 14 penetrates through the sliding block 15, the limit rod 14 is arranged on the mounting sleeve 5, and the limit rod 14 can prevent the sliding block 15 from swinging left and right when moving to affect unlocking of the device.
Referring to fig. 2, the fixing sleeve 1 and the mounting sleeve 5 are both provided with bolts 22, the bolts 22 fix the fixing sleeve 1 and the mounting sleeve 5, the support frame 9 is provided with a pull rod 2 in a penetrating way, the pull rod 2 is provided with an extrusion spring 24, when the handle 6 is not used, can rotate with the second rotary cylinder 3 through the supporting frame 9 and is fixed by the pull rod 2 penetrating through the hole on the handle 6, thereby reducing the utilization rate of space, a protective tube 18 is sleeved on the steel wire rope 11, a sliding block 19 is arranged on the moving block 29, the fixed sleeve 1 is internally provided with a slider groove 23, the slider 19 is arranged in the slider groove 23 in a penetrating manner, the steel wire rope 11 can be protected by the protection tube 18, the service life of the steel wire rope 11 is prolonged, and the slider 19 and the slider groove 23 can prevent the moving block 29 from swinging left and right when pulled upwards to influence the stability of the device.
